LiSa is a software tool that allows users to manipulate audio in real-time by sampling and processing live audio. It provides a comprehensive environment for live sound manipulation.
With this combination, the Mac transforms into an incredibly versatile audio sampling machine able to generate up to 128 voices under the complete program control of the user via MIDI. This makes it ideal for use in a performance environment.
The system features a stereo sample buffer, the size of which depends on the amount of memory allocated to LiSa. The user can define various zones, which have access to different portions of the sample buffer. A library of more than two thousand zones can be created, with each zone having five different functions including playing, recording and reading audio data to or from the buffer.
Since the user can access these zones through MIDI, the top layer of the system is organized into "presets." Each preset allows the user to assign zones to one or more MIDI note events. LiSa X can store up to 128 presets, each of which can load a "preset page" (sample file) into the sample buffer in various ways.
One of the key features of LiSa X is that users can record new samples at any time in the sample buffer, not just while other zones are active. Additionally, more than one recording zone can be active simultaneously, enabling users to record samples in different parts of the buffer at the same time.
LiSa X also provides real-time control over more than thirty parameters, including zone start point and length, filters, playback behavior, time stretching, and pitch shifting. Users can achieve this control through direct MIDI access or internal modulators, which can also be controlled by MIDI or other modulators.
LiSa X comes equipped with a range of new features and improvements over previous versions, including MIDI processors, MIDI snapshots, more playback filters, an enhanced user interface, and more powerful modulators.
This latest release of LiSa X also includes multichannel CoreAudio support with automatic overload detection and panic support, CoreMidi MIDI support, low latencies, enhanced MIDI processors, and extended modulators.
